Keep Comfortable When Doing Your Hobby with Fishing Gloves

A glove is a fitted sheathing fabric you use on your hands to protect them from cold weather, or from becoming scratched or bruised. They are usually extended to the wrist and in some circumstances, even continue further up the arm for even more protection.
Fishing gloves vary from plain fabric to nylon and even leather for better protection. Their main purpose is to protect you from cold, sharp and wet surfaces during fishing. A lot of modern fishing gloves are now manufactured and tailored to particular kinds of fishing. Recreational fishing requires less detail when it comes to hand gloves when compared to those that are needed for professionals.
Different kinds of gloves:
½ finger gloves - These will allow half your fingers to protrude and extend outside the glove for easy gripping, such as when tying material and hooks.
Glomitts - Glomitts, also known as glove mittens, cover the whole of your hands. They are commonly waterproof to keep your hands dry inside. This will also make gripping easier and will provide extra protection from your hands getting punctured by pointed materials.
Fish handling gloves - Fish handling gloves are made of puncture resistant fabric material to protect your hands from harmful fish fins.
Cut resistant gloves - This kind of glove is made from super tough fabric to increase protection to your hands when cutting fish.
Wind shear gloves - Wind shear gloves protect your hands from ice cold, bone chilling weather. It has thin neoprene palms for easy grip and is designed as a glove mitten to protect your hands from harsh weather.
Glacier gloves - Glacier gloves are rugged and wind proof. They can be extended up your arm and provide extraordinary warmth. They have a stretchable, waterproof neoprene palm and breathable fleece back.
Sun gloves - Sun gloves are almost similar to ½ finger gloves, only, they cover the wrist part and do not extend to any part of your fingers. They are best used to protect your palm from blisters and cuts.
Wool gloves - For fishermen who just want to warm up their hands while fishing, wool gloves are also available. They can extend from the tips of your fingers all the way down to your wrist or arm part. They are not waterproof, but they do provide a great deal of warmth to your hands.
Fishing can be fun. While most people go fishing for fun, others do this as their primary means of living. Either way, it is still best to keep yourself protected from the harmful effects of your surroundings and the fish you are trying to catch.
Fishing gloves are not just decorative accessories that you use when fishing. They have an important role in protecting your hands and skin. Choose the best type of glove to suit your style of fishing and you may even need to consider those that are hypoallergenic. Sensitive skin can react with the salt water and the fabric of the gloves.
